WebCorporation income tax return All resident corporations (except tax-exempt Crown corporations, Hutterite colonies and registered charities) have to file a corporation income tax (T2) return every tax year even if there is no tax payable. This includes: non-profit organizations tax-exempt corporations inactive corporations
